Composition: Regulated Greenfield (V-Model + DDD + Cleanroom + Waterfall)

HIPAA-compliant patient-portal archetype: Waterfall stage sequencing over DDD clinical-domain modeling, Cleanroom formal specification/verification for PHI-handling components, and V-Model paired verification levels with per-component parallel verification. Every stage exit is guarded by an **executed** requirement-to-verification traceability gate plus a routed qa-lead sign-off breakpoint; PHI access and production deploy are policy-gated compliance-officer breakpoints that never auto-execute.

Stage map

Code
  Waterfall stage           Ingredient ownership (left V | right V)
  ---------------           ----------------------------------------
  Stage 1 Requirements      waterfall:requirements-gathering (SRS)
                            v-model:requirements-with-acceptance ----+
                            crg:phi-classification                   |
  Stage 2 Domain modeling   ddd strategic+tactical tasks             |
                            v-model:system-design-with-system-test -+|
  Stage 3 Formal spec       cleanroom:create-formal-specification   ||
   (PHI components)         cleanroom:design-with-verification      ||
                            v-model:architecture-with-integration -+||
                            v-model:module-design-with-unit-test -+|||
  Stage 4 Implementation    crg:implement-component               ||||
  Stage 5 Verification      v-model:execute-tests  unit <---------+|||
                             + cleanroom:code-inspection (PHI)     |||
                            v-model:execute-tests  integration <---+||
                            v-model:execute-tests  system <---------+|
                            v-model:execute-tests  acceptance <------+
  Stage 6 Deploy            v-model:traceability-matrix (full)
                            waterfall:deployment (guarded)

Every stage boundary runs regulatedStageExit (see contract below). Stage boundaries are strictly sequential; ctx.parallel.all is used only *within* a stage.

Stage-exit contract (`regulatedStageExit`)

1. **Executed traceability check** — traceabilityMatrixTask computes the stage's requirement->artifact->test matrix; crg.trace-diff diffs it against the previous stage's stored matrix and the SRS requirement set, writing artifacts/crg/<stage>/trace-diff.json with {coveredCount, uncovered, orphanedTests, regressions} — a computed diff, not prose. 2. **Adversarial gate** — adversarialGate (gateId: crg.<stage>.traceability) over the executed diff with traceability-critic + phi-provenance-critic, IRON LAW ("re-run the trace computation yourself or cite trace-diff.json line-by-line"), the built-in gate fixer, maxFixAttempts budget, and owner escalation. A failed gate blocks the stage. 3. **qa-lead sign-off** — routedBreakpoint with the per-stage-unique crg.stage-exit.<stage> id. Payload schema:

``json { "question": "...", "stage": "<stage>", "traceDiff": { "coveredCount": 0, "uncovered": [], "orphanedTests": [], "regressions": [] }, "gateResult": { "passed": true, "attempts": 1, "escalated": false, "evidence": [] }, "artifacts": ["artifacts/crg/<stage>/trace-diff.json"] } ``

The payload is built from the executed gate result, so sign-off without traceability evidence is structurally impossible. 4. **Rejected sign-off throws** — stage boundaries are sequential; there is no skip-ahead path.
